WASHINGTON -- The Associated Press has learned that federal agents have a convicted felon under arrest for providing the gun later used to kill ex-NFL quarterback Steve McNair.
Two law enforcement officials, speaking on condition of anonymity because they were not authorized to discuss the case, say the suspect has been arrested by agents with the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ives.
Federal prosecutors in Nashville plan to announce the charges at a press conference later Friday.
McNair was shot to death on July 4 at his condo by his 20-year-old mistress Sahel Kazemi, who then turned the gun on herself. Police have said Kazemi bought the gun in a private sale from a person they haven't identified.
